Rebecca has initiated a partnership between the schools in Mutsora and Mutwanga and St. Stephen’s & St. Agne’s Schools in Alexandria, Virginia. I personally, would have a hard time putting my finger on a map in either of these places in the DR Congo and in the USA but this is exactly the kind of thing that kicks me about the world wide web! People that care can connect to others anywhere in the world and people who care can reach out and help any place in the world that need a helping hand.

bonjour-1.JPG

The BIG NEWS is that Rachel, friends and the schools recently held a fundraiser and being as humble as she is, mentioned in passing that they raised between $6,000-$7,000 USD!! What more can we say except that we are in this for the long haul with you for the children of eastern Congo, and the gorillas.
